Growth Drivers & Opportunities:
The Polybutylene Terephthalate (PBT) market is benefitting from a variety of growth drivers that are propelling its expansion. One significant factor is the increasing demand for PBT in the automotive industry. As manufacturers strive to create lighter and more fuel-efficient vehicles, PBT emerges as an attractive alternative due to its excellent strength-to-weight ratio and resistance to heat and chemicals. The ongoing trend towards electric vehicles also opens new avenues for PBT, as it is used in components such as battery housings and electrical connectors.
Furthermore, the electronics industry is witnessing a surge in demand for PBT due to its favorable electrical properties. PBT serves as an effective insulator and is utilized in the production of circuit boards, connectors, and other electronic components. The rapid advancement in technology and the rise of smart devices are likely to sustain this growth, presenting opportunities for manufacturers to innovate and expand their product offerings.
Another area of opportunity lies in the growing focus on sustainable and eco-friendly materials. As industries seek to reduce their environmental impact, there is potential for bio-derived and recycled PBT products. This shift can attract environmentally conscious consumers and open new markets that prioritize sustainability, driving further growth in the PBT sector.

Industry Restraints:
Despite the positive growth outlook, the PBT market faces several restraints that could hinder its progress. One of the primary challenges is the volatility in raw material prices, primarily due to fluctuations in crude oil prices. As PBT is derived from petroleum-based resources, any instability in the supply chain can affect production costs and pricing, ultimately impacting profitability for manufacturers.
Moreover, the presence of alternative materials such as polycarbonate and polyamide poses a competitive threat to PBT. These materials often offer similar properties but may be more readily available or cost-effective. This competition can lead to a market saturation where PBT struggles to maintain its market share, especially in applications where customers prioritize price over performance.
Regulatory challenges also represent a significant constraint for the PBT market. As environmental regulations tighten globally, manufacturers may face pressure to comply with stricter guidelines regarding emissions and waste. This can lead to increased operational costs and necessitate investments in cleaner technologies, which can be particularly burdensome for smaller companies lacking resources.

Type Segment Analysis
The Polybutylene Terephthalate (PBT) market is primarily segmented based on type into unfilled and filled PBT. Among these, filled PBT, which includes mineral-filled and glass fiber-filled variants, is expected to exhibit the largest market size due to its enhanced mechanical properties and dimensional stability. This type is widely preferred in applications requiring superior strength and rigidity, making it favorable in the automotive and electrical sectors. Unfilled PBT, while retaining a significant market share, is projected to grow at a slower rate compared to its filled counterpart as industries increasingly demand materials that offer enhanced performance characteristics, especially in high-stress applications.
End-Use Industry Analysis
The end-use segment of the PBT market includes automotive, electrical and electronics, consumer goods, and industrial applications. The automotive segment is anticipated to dominate the market due to the rising demand for lightweight materials that help improve fuel efficiency and reduce carbon emissions. Components such as connectors, housings, and various interior parts benefit from the unique properties of PBT. In the electrical and electronics segment, PBT is favored for its excellent insulating properties and thermal stability, which contribute to its increasing adoption in producing various electronic components. Consumer goods represent another growing application as manufacturers look for durable and aesthetically appealing materials for household products. The industrial application segment, while smaller, is witnessing steady growth as PBT is used in mechanical components and industrial tools due to its robustness.
